The Importance of Market Research
Market research acts as the foundation for strategic business decisions. By gathering and analyzing data about your market, competitors, and consumers, you can:
- Identify Opportunities: Discover gaps in the market that your business can fill.
- Understand Customer Needs: Gain insights into what your customers value and how their preferences are evolving.
- Assess Competition: Learn about your competitors' strengths and weaknesses, helping you position your brand effectively.
1. Types of Market Research
There are two primary types of market research you can conduct:
- Primary Research: Gather firsthand data through surveys, interviews, focus groups, and direct observations. This method is beneficial for getting insights tailored to your specific needs.
- Secondary Research: Analyze existing data from reports, studies, and publications. This can save time and resources, especially for understanding broader market trends.
2. Tools for Conducting Market Research
Utilizing the right tools will enhance your market research efforts:
- Online Surveys: Platforms like SurveyMonkey or Google Forms allow you to create detailed surveys to collect feedback from your target audience.
- Social Media Analytics: Tools like Hootsuite or Sprout Social provide insights into consumer behavior and trends in real-time.
- Data Analysis Software: Use software like Tableau or Excel for analyzing large datasets and creating visual reports to comprehend patterns.
3. Interpreting Market Research Insights
Once you've collected data, it's crucial to analyze it effectively:
- Identify Key Trends: Look for patterns in consumer behavior or emerging market trends that can influence your business strategy.
- Dive into Demographics: Understand the age, gender, income, and preferences of your target audience to tailor your offerings effectively.
- Feedback Utilization: Incorporate consumer feedback to refine products or services and improve customer satisfaction.
4. Implementing Research Insights
With the gathered insights, it's time to take action:
- Develop Targeted Marketing Campaigns: Use your research to craft messages that resonate with your audience.
- Optimize Product Offerings: Adjust your products or services based on customer preferences and trends.
- Monitor Competitors: Stay informed about competitor strategies to adapt and innovate continuously.
